Concept 5: Ionization Techniques
1
Mass Spectrometrist Definitions:
Electrospray:
formation of charged liquid droplets from which ions are desolvated or desorbed.
MALDI: (matrix assisted laser desorption ionization.)
impact of high energy photons on a sample imbedded in a solid organic matrix.
Layperson Understanding:
None. How does this relate to weighing molecules?
Simple Definition:
Ionization is a process of charging a molecule. Molecules must be charged in order to measure them using a mass spectrometer. "It makes a molecule fly in a mass spectrometer."
